Red Bull Games Australia recently went hands-on with a fresh version of Super Mario Odyssey and writes:
"The addition of Cappy is clearly the hook here, just like the water-based jetpack from Super Mario Sunshine. But unlike the excellent but scrappy Sunshine, the larger size of the worlds and overall scope never feel too big or stray too far from the core simplicity that made Super Mario 64 one of the all-time greats. It’s a testament to the talent at Nintendo, that they’re still able to create such brilliant slices of 3D platforming. And like with The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ild, uncompromising stuff too. With Mario having to time jumps to perfection and navigate platforms so thin that at times you’ll wonder if they’re even there.
With a story all about collecting Power Moons and stopping Bowser from pulling off his latest spiky-shelled scheme, there’s also a feeling of celebration to be found throughout Super Mario Odyssey. Or, the bits that we got to play. Which ultimately comes down to the design, and the sheer number of fun and varied ideas you can come across even in a brief 90-minute play session. See a rather blocky green pipe at the base of a wall? Enter it and you’ll get to play-through a wall-sized 8-bit Mario challenge inspired by look and feel of the NES original."
